I have been thinking about doing some article-writing to fill in some downtime here and there. The pick-it-up-when-you-want-it approach of Textbroker would suit me fine, even if the rates are not the highest, as I do not have time to run a Warriors for Hire, or hunt around too much for clients (never mind bid for them through eLance etc.) I would prefer just to check in every now and then when I have time and pick up what's available.

Textbroker only accepts US authors. Does anyone know of an equivalent for UK or international authors, that still has reasonable rates, quality control, native-speakers-only, etc? (Yes, I have Googled around, without too much light shed on the subject).

  • Thanks for reminding me about Constant Content - I had forgotten about them. It's a somewhat different model to TB but I think I could make that work.
  • If you're absolutely desperate there's London Brokers. I haven't used them personally but I've heard they pay out regulary via Paypal. Be warned though, they claim $5 per article but they usually want 3 versions (the original + 2 re-writes). Like I said, only if you're desperate.
